#1da400 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1da400 is composed of 11.4% red, 64.3%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 35.7% black. It has a hue angle of 109.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 32.2%. #1da400 color hex could be obtained by blending #3aff00 with #004900.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#1da400

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010700 is the darkest color, while #f5fff2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1da400

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e584c is the less saturated color, while #1da400 is the most saturated one.
